A taste of heaven with this Apples, Cheese and Cider Agri-Tour. Start this tour with a visit to the mountainside Carmelis Alpine Goat Cheese Artisan farm and sample their European-style cheeses overlooking the spectacular Okanagan Lake. Carmelis is a family-owned dairy “boutique” with 80 goats raised in a natural environment and treated like ‘kids’. The cheeses are produced on a small scale which allows close monitoring of each and every cheese. Traditional techniques, learned in Europe, are used in the production of the cheeses, which are made from 100% goat milk.
Then, an orchard tour at Kelowna Land & Orchard Co. reveals how modern technology is used to grow “the perfect apple”. The orchard tour is conducted on a comfortable covered hay wagon for a behind the scenes look at this high tech modern working farm located in this historic orchard established in 1904. Complete the tour with tastings of the unique apple ice cider produced by Raven Ridge Cidery, a new cidery located on-site at the orchard.
